Transaction 58595705f7ef2a285287b600087f3aede2143df02218fba3da53f60e18efc568
1 Input
1 Output
-
58595705f7ef2a285287b600087f3aede2143df02218fba3da53f60e18efc568:0
- value
- 766876
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8cf1f6d9ebc20206a409ffa52c6af12be224cd9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LmP5aVdKxEg3MhysMr3mRgJrQQHo9GraQ